Insulated glass

If you're looking to lower your energy bills it is recommended to invest in insulated glass windows. These windows are made to cool your home during the summer, and heating it in the winter. They can reduce the amount of noise pollution.

Insulated windows are constructed from two or more panes of glass, separated by the spacer. The spacer is filled with air or gas to fill the gap between the panes. The insulation level can be improved by adding the third or fourth layer to the glass.

Egress window glass

Egress windows are an excellent method of increasing the ventilation in your basement. They can also be used in the event there is an emergency fire. But, they must to be placed and sized appropriately.

Local building codes are the best method to determine if your basement needs windows for egress. These guidelines will provide you with the exact requirements. There are rules regarding the square footage, minimum height and minimum width. Typically, the egress windows must be a minimum of 24 inches tall and 20 inches wide to conform with the code.
